I’m looking for some options for a quick render of an animation. I need to show a client the motion before I do the full render. Its 1950 frames, so lower samples still won’t be “quick”. I know you can do a wireframe, but this is a bit difficult to look at; the scene has a lot of objects. Is there a way to do what you see as the solid view, or the material view in the view port?

Yep. Set the view how you want it then select “OpenGL Render Animation” from the render menu (up top, in the info bar). You can also click the clapboard button at the bottom right of the 3D view, it does the same thing.

To add to that, if you just want the size of the viewport choose an orthographic view. If you OpenGL render the viewport with the active camera selected, however, you inherit the render settings for the scene.
